About The Position

The Measurement Safety & Training Manager partners with Measurement and other Technology, Market Relations, Customer Engagement (TMMC) leadership and field teams to provide strategic direction, subject-matter expertise, and culture-building support that advances worker, vehicle, and public safety while ensuring effective, compliant training across all Measurement activities. The role also ensures consistency with Oncor Corporate Safety initiatives. The role leads the design, delivery, and governance of Measurement safety programs and performance-based training, maintains compliance with applicable regulations and company policies, and uses data-driven insights to reduce risk and improve outcomes. Responsibilities

  • Lead, coach, and develop a team (Training Representative; Senior Safety Representative), including workforce planning, hiring, performance management, and retention.
  • Serve as the primary Measurement safety and training business partner to leaders and local districts; provide hands-on field support and consultation.
  • Provide Subject Matter Expert (SME) guidance on applicable safety regulations and consensus standards (e.g.,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), National Fire Protection Association (NFPA), National Electrical Safety Code (NESC) as applicable to Measurement work environments and electrical hazards) and ensure compliant safety work practices across Measurement field and shop activities.
  • Lead and/or participate in incident and event investigations; identify root causes, corrective actions, and lessons learned communications.
  • Govern Measurement safety committees, annual Safety Action Plans, seminars, and handbook reviews/updates within scope.
  • Oversee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) and safety equipment specification/evaluation with Supply Chain and manufacturers (e.x. Flame-Resistant (FR) garments, dielectric testing programs) as applicable to Measurement.
  • Provide support during emergencies and storm response for Measurement safety.
  • Own the end-to-end training lifecycle for Measurement (analysis, design, development, delivery, evaluation, continuous improvement) using a variety of instructional methods and technologies aligned to learning principles.
  • Maintain and improve training facilities/equipment to support safe, realistic training scenarios; ensure proper operation and maintenance.
  • Establish and execute a multi-year strategic training plan for Measurement that aligns with business needs and risk profile.
  • Manage guest instructors, vendors, and contractors involved in training and related services.
  • Ensure accurate completion, retention, and audit readiness of training records and program materials.
  • Lead the design, implementation, and governance of Measurement’s safety/Human and Organizational Performance (HOP) Software as a Service (SaaS) platforms (e.g., incident management, safety observations, pre-job briefings, inspections, near-miss reporting) and drive adoption and data quality.
  • Analyze safety and human performance data to identify trends, strengths, and improvement opportunities; recommend and track actions to closure.
  • Provide technical guidance and partnership to Measurement leaders, project teams, and internal customers to achieve safety and training objectives.
  • Build and maintain an external network; participate in industry groups/committees to influence codes/standards beneficial to the company and the Measurement discipline.
  • Plan and manage Operations and Maintenance (O&M) and capital budgets for safety and training operations in line with company policies and expectations; manage contracts for related services.
  • Ensure compliance with applicable federal, state, and local safety regulations and company policies across Measurement safety and training programs.
